Meteor - National Geographic Society
https://www.nationalgeographic.org/encyclopedia/meteor/
WEBOct 19, 2023 · A meteor is a streak of light in the sky caused by a meteoroid crashing through Earth’s atmosphere. Meteoroids are lumps of rock or iron that orbit the sun. Most meteoroids are small fragments of rock created by asteroid collisions. Comets also create meteoroids as they orbit the sun and shed dust and debris.

Meteors and Meteorites: Facts - Science@NASA
https://science.nasa.gov/solar-system/meteors-meteorites/facts/
WEBThere are three major types of meteorites: the "irons," the "stonys," and the "stony-irons." Although the majority of meteorites that fall to Earth are stony, most of the meteorites discovered long after they fall are irons. Irons are heavier and easier to distinguish from Earth rocks than stony meteorites.

Ten Facts About Meteors - NASA
https://www.nasa.gov/wp-content/uploads/2021/08/741990main_ten_meteor_facts.pdf
WEBA meteor shower occurs when the Earth passes through the trail of debris left by a comet or asteroid. Meteors are bits of rocks and ice ejected from comets as they move in their orbits about the sun. A meteor that reaches the ground it is called a meteorite. Meteor showers get their names from the constellation in where their radiant is located.
